Methodist and Xxxxxxx Sample Clauses

Methodist and Xxxxxxx. HMA and HMA agree that the unemployment experience of Methodist will be transferred to Xxxxxxx/HMA if such a transfer of unemployment experience is allowed by law and elected by Xxxxxxx/HMA. If the payroll of the Facilities is reported in an unemployment insurance account with other payroll prior to the Closing, the portion of the unemployment experience transferred to Xxxxxxx/HMA shall be the same portion as the Facilities' state unemployment taxable payroll bears to the total state unemployment taxable payroll of Methodist's unemployment insurance account. Funds, if any, which are in group accounts for the purpose of paying reimbursable unemployment benefits will be transferred to Xxxxxxx/HMA if Xxxxxxx/HMA elects such transfer. Obligations to reimburse the state for unemployment benefits relating to persons who do not become employees of Xxxxxxx/HMA at Closing shall continue to be the obligations of Methodist. Methodist agrees to make available to Xxxxxxx/HMA the records of individual wages of all employees, as well as copies of state unemployment tax returns, to the extent necessary for Xxxxxxx/HMA to verify future unemployment tax rates and to calculate the correct taxable payroll for the remainder of the calendar year in which the transaction occurs.

  • Xxxxx Xxxxxxx If immediately prior to the third anniversary (the “Renewal Deadline”) of the initial effective date of the Registration Statement, any of the Shares remain unsold by the Underwriters, the Company will, prior to the Renewal Deadline, file, if it has not already done so and is eligible to do so, a new automatic shelf registration statement relating to the Shares, in a form satisfactory to the Representative. If the Company is not eligible to file an automatic shelf registration statement, the Company will, prior to the Renewal Deadline, if it has not already done so, file a new shelf registration statement relating to the Shares, in a form satisfactory to the Representative, and will use its best efforts to cause such registration statement to be declared effective within 180 days after the Renewal Deadline. The Company will take all other action necessary or appropriate to permit the issuance and sale of the Shares to continue as contemplated in the expired registration statement relating to the Shares. References herein to the Registration Statement shall include such new automatic shelf registration statement or such new shelf registration statement, as the case may be.
